For those who can fly to Las Vegas on Southwest, their winter fare sale starts today! The WCAF/PPFA Convention dates are included!!!!
We just got $49 (one way) tickets!
If you collect airline miles/points - the best way to maximize this purchase is to buy Southwest Gift Cards at an office supply store (like Staples) using the Chase Ink card. You will get 5x Ultimate Reward Points, plus the ticket counts as a revenue ticket so you will also get Southwest Airlines points when you fly.
For a limited time, Chase is offering 70,000 Ultimate Reward points for a Chase Ink sign up. There is an annual fee (not waived) of $95 for the card. However, those 70,000 points earned (after meeting the minimum spend requirement) can be redeemed for $700 CASH so for a $95 investment, you get at $605 return. If you save those points (and add to them with credit card spending) they can be transferred (immediately at no fee) to United Airlines, Southwest Airlines, Marriott and Hyatt Hotels and have other uses that can make the $605 earned worth a LOT more.
If you have a business, the Chase Ink card is one you should be using. If you are a husband and wife, each can apply for a card in their own name. That DOUBLES the potential sign up bonus for a CASH return of $1210 for a $190 investment.
